Лого Black-Minecraft.com
Ты перешёл на тёмную сторону.
Мы в социальных сетях
Decor
Attachment Improvements By Xon

💠 Слив Аддон XF 2.x.x Attachment Improvements By Xon [2.3.2]
Краткое описание: Расширения для системы вложений XenForo.

Нет прав для скачивания
Так как этот ресурс находится в категории «СЛИВ», мы не можем гарантировать его обновление! Но будем стараться обновлять ресурс до последней версии.
Реакции:
Источник
https://xenforo.com/community/resources/attachment-improvements-by-xon.6629/
Поддерживаемые версии
  1. 2.1
  2. 2.2

Описание плагина Attachment Improvements By Xon:​

Набор улучшений для системы вложений в XF.
  • Опция удаления EXIF-данных jpeg
  • Поддержка SVG
  • X-Accel-Redirect в Nginx
  • Новые разрешения для форума/разговоров (соблюдаются глобальные ограничения на размер и количество вложений):
    • Размер вложения (кб).
    • Максимальное количество вложений.
  • Добавлена поддержка видеопотока через запросы частичного содержимого

Поддержка SVG в плагине Attachment Improvements By Xon:​

Поддержка вложений SVG для отображения их как обычных изображений.

Nginx X-Accel-Redirect (OPTIONAL)​


Включает использование функции заголовка Nginx X-Accel-Redirect для обслуживания вложений.

Это позволяет XenForo выполнять проверку и аутентификацию, а также перегружать фактическую передачу файлов на Nginx. Эта функция не очень хорошо документирована, но некоторую информацию можно найти Для просмотра ссылки Войди или Зарегистрируйся.

Этот аддон предполагает, что папка /internal_data существует в webroot, и у вас нет оператора 'deny all;', а вместо него используется 'internal;' для защиты папки internal_data.

Например, XenForo доступен из: /forum, а не из webroot.

В файл config.php необходимо добавить следующее:
Код:
$config['internalDataUrl'] = '/forum/internal_data';
В вашем веб-сервере может потребоваться что-то похожее на конфигурацию nginx:
Код:
location ^~ /forum/internal_data {
  internal;
  add_header Etag $upstream_http_etag;
  add_header X-Frame-Options SAMEORIGIN;
  add_header X-Content-Type-Options nosniff;
  alias /path/to/internal_data;
}
Чтобы обеспечить соответствие тому, как XenForo обслуживает файлы, добавьте следующие заголовки в конфигурацию вашего сайта для папки internal_data:
Код:
  add_header Etag $upstream_http_etag;
  add_header X-Frame-Options SAMEORIGIN;
  add_header X-Content-Type-Options nosniff;

Новые разрешения​

Разрешает ограничения на размер и количество вложений для каждого форума или беседы.

Соблюдаются глобальные ограничения на размер/количество вложений для всего форума, при этом настройки для каждой группы пользователей позволяют устанавливать меньшие значения.

Из-за того, как работают целочисленные разрешения в XF, 'unlimited' или '0' считаются отсутствием разрешения.

Инструкции по установке​

Добавьте расширение файла 'svg' в список поддерживаемых, чтобы разрешить загрузку файлов svg.
Автор
Red_Dragon
Первый выпуск
Обновление
Рейтинг
0,00 звёзд Оценок: 0

Еще ресурсы от Red_Dragon

Верх